I noticed this little oddity when I was moving my nickel collection from the cardboard folders to a post album. As you can see, it's a 1971-D Jefferson nickel. My interest is in the placement of the mint marks. One of the Ds seems to be a lot lower than the other. Comments?
Up until 1990 all mint marks were put onto each die by hand, so you will see a lot of variation in the locations.
Dat's right. Hand-punched mintmarks were required to be within a certain range but their location could vary, sometimes quite a bit.
